ADVERTISEMENT FOR BIDS

Sealed Bids for the construction of the Gadsen Loop Water Upgrades will be received by the City of Walterboro in Council Chambers at Walterboro City Hall located at 242 Hampton Street Walterboro, SC 29488 until 2:00 pm local time on September 26, 2023, at which time the Bids will be publicly opened and read.  The Project consists of approximately 5,036 linear feet (LF) of new 6-inch water mains to replace existing small-diameter water mains, 7 new fire hydrants, valves, and all appurtenances to perform the work located along Gadsden Loop and Jackson Road. 

Bids will be received for a single prime Contract.  Bids shall be on a unit-item basis, with alternate bid items as indicated in the Bid Form.

This project is being funded in whole or in part by the Community Development Block Grant Program (CDBG).  All federal CDBG requirements will apply to the contract. All contractors and subcontractors are required to be registered in the federal System for Award Management (SAM). Bidders on this work will be required to comply with the President’s Executive Order No. 11246 & Order No. 11375 which prohibits discrimination in employment regarding race, creed, color, sex, or national origin.  Bidders must comply with Title VI if the Civil Rights Act of 1964, the Davis-Bacon Act, the Anti-Kickback Act, the Contract Work Hours and Safety Standards Act, and 40 CFR 33.240. 

Bidders must also make positive efforts to use small and minority-owned businesses and to offer employment, training, and contracting opportunities in accordance with Section 3 of the Housing and Urban Development Act of 1968.  Attention of bidders is particularly called to the requirements as to conditions of employment to be observed and minimum wage rates to be paid under the contract.
